    I have a PS2 version SCPH-30001 R and wanted a modchip.

    So i went to my retailer and they said that if i was going to get a modchip for this version of PS2 it would usually last about a year or so because of the laser it has ..the older version

    so was wondering if anyone else has this kind of model and their PS2 lasted longer than a year.

    By the way i think the chip they have is Magic 3.1

    i agree, don't buy that Magic Chip.
    Get a better quality chip like DMS4 Pro or Matrix Infinity
    if your worried get a laser fix, but the V9 is the only older model that i have ever heard of having any kind of laser problem.
    But better safe then sorry since the fix is only like $10

    there's no laser fix for v5/6 ps2. and yes dont buy a magic 3.1 its the worst i ever tried. i'd go for a Duo chip which costs only slightly more than magic. the lens will last for a few years if your ps2 has been under ultilised till now.
